DAV Energy Solutions was awarded Definitive Contract 36C26025C0044 (36C260-25-C-0044) for 663-25-900 Study For Hvac System Improvement worth up to $1,392,916 by VISN 20: Northwest Network in September 2025. The contract has a duration of 6 months and was awarded through solicitation 663-25-900 | Study for HVAC System Improvement, Seattle WA with a Service Disabled Veteran Owned Small Business set aside with NAICS 541330 and PSC C223 via architect-engineer FAR 6.102 acquisition procedures with 15 bids received.
